Shane Garcia | Prep Hoops Scout
I like the type of player Taylor is. He had great energy all day and was constantly talking and having fun while playing during this showcase. He is a pass-first player who makes his teammates play a little harder off the ball. He is constantly looking for the next pass and open teammate. I wish he would look to the rim a little more when he gets the ball to see how he would be as a scorer.

Taylor was a standout at the Prep Hoops freshman showcase last August and also really impressed me with his Midwest Cincy MHC squad in the spring. A fluid mover on the wing, Taylor can change pace and direction when attacking closeouts and has the length to score at the rim. I also was impressed by his natural defensive instincts and how he moved without the basketball in the half-court. Moeller is stacked in the 2028 and 2029 classes so not sure how much we’ll get to see Taylor this winter but he has an extremely bright future ahead.

Midwest Cincy MHC has a really nice 15 U group and I caught them in a blowout victory to open up Midwest Mania. I liked how Taylor moved on the court, covering a lot of ground and fluidly changing directions. A wing who can handle the basketball and swing passes across the court, Taylor helps push the pace. Taylor was a standout at our Prep Hoops Freshman showcase and continued to impress in an organized 5 on 5 setting last weekend.
